Liquidity Dynamics in Futures Trading
Liquidity dynamics in futures trading refer to how easily contracts can be bought or sold without significantly impacting their price. Higher liquidity typically results in narrower bid-ask spreads, facilitating more efficient trades for market participants. Several factors influence these dynamics, including trading volume, market depth, and the presence of active market makers.
Trading volumes are a primary driver of liquidity in futures markets; increased activity tends to enhance liquidity by attracting more participants and stabilizing prices. Conversely, low volumes can cause wider spreads and increased volatility, making it harder to execute large trades without price shifts. Market stability often depends on maintaining sufficient liquidity, especially during periods of market stress or volatility.
The interplay between futures trading and overall market liquidity is complex. Liquidity in futures markets can spill over into the underlying cash markets, affecting price discovery and efficiency. Market participants, including institutional and retail investors, significantly influence liquidity provision through their trading activity, either by entering or withdrawing from the market.
Factors Affecting Liquidity in Futures Markets
Several key factors influence liquidity in futures markets, shaping how easily traders can buy or sell contracts without causing significant price changes. Market size, or trading volume, is a primary determinant, as higher volumes typically result in better liquidity. Larger markets with more active participants offer more liquidity because there are more opportunities to execute trades at desired prices.
Market participants’ diversity also impacts liquidity. A wide range of institutional traders, hedgers, and speculators creates a competitive environment that enhances liquidity. Conversely, a limited number of traders can lead to wider bid-ask spreads and reduced market depth, negatively affecting liquidity. Additionally, price volatility affects liquidity levels, since heightened price swings can cause traders to hesitate, reducing overall market activity.
External factors, such as regulatory policies and technological infrastructure, also play vital roles. Regulations that promote transparency and market accessibility tend to improve liquidity by attracting more participants. Similarly, advanced trading systems and high-speed networks facilitate faster execution and more efficient price discovery, further supporting liquidity in futures trading.

Price Stability and Liquidity Fluctuations
Price stability in futures markets is closely linked to market liquidity, as sufficient liquidity helps absorb large trades without causing significant price swings. When liquidity is high, prices tend to reflect true market values more accurately, reducing volatility. Conversely, low liquidity can lead to sharp fluctuations, making prices more unpredictable and challenging to manage.
Liquidity fluctuations often occur due to variations in trading volumes, macroeconomic events, or changes in market sentiment. Sudden drops in liquidity can cause increased bid-ask spreads, impairing market efficiency and heightening volatility. Market participants must monitor these fluctuations carefully, as they directly impact the stability of futures prices.
Futures exchanges deploy mechanisms such as circuit breakers and trading halts to mitigate the effects of liquidity-driven price instability. These measures aim to maintain orderly markets, especially during periods of stress. Throughout these efforts, the interplay between liquidity and price stability remains fundamental to ensuring fair and efficient futures trading environments.

Market Participants and Their Role in Liquidity Provision
Market participants play a vital role in providing liquidity in futures trading by actively engaging in buying and selling contracts. Their participation ensures continuous market activity, which facilitates price discovery and reduces volatility, making markets more efficient.
Different types of participants, such as institutional investors, proprietary trading firms, hedge funds, and retail traders, contribute uniquely to liquidity provision. Institutional investors often execute large trades, which can impact market depth and stability, while retail traders tend to provide smaller, more frequent orders that help maintain order flow.
Market makers and authorized participants are especially significant in futures markets, as they guarantee liquidity by quoting prices at which they are willing to buy or sell. Their ability to step in quickly to fill gaps in supply helps prevent drastic price swings and enhances overall market stability.
The active involvement of these participants, supported by regulatory frameworks and technological advancements, is fundamental in maintaining market liquidity, especially during periods of stress or high volatility. Their collective efforts underpin the smooth functioning of futures exchanges and the broader financial system.
The Significance of Margin Requirements and Settlement Systems
Margin requirements and settlement systems are vital components in futures trading that directly influence market liquidity. By setting minimum collateral levels, margin requirements ensure that traders have sufficient funds, reducing counterparty risk and promoting stability. This, in turn, fosters confidence among market participants and enhances liquidity provision.
Settlement systems facilitate the timely and efficient transfer of ownership and funds after trading occurs. Robust systems minimize settlement failures and delays, maintaining continuous market activity. Effective settlement procedures help mitigate systemic risks, encouraging traders and institutions to participate actively, which sustains market liquidity.
Overall, margin requirements and settlement systems serve as foundational mechanisms that underpin the integrity and efficiency of futures exchanges. Their proper implementation not only stabilizes the market but also attracts diverse participants, contributing to a more liquid and resilient futures trading environment.

Measures to Enhance Transparency and Reduce Volatility
Implementing greater transparency in futures markets involves mandatory disclosure of trading activities, order book data, and historical price movements. Such measures enable market participants to make informed decisions, thereby reducing information asymmetry and fostering confidence.
Regulatory initiatives often require real-time reporting of large trades and open interest data, which can help identify potential market manipulations or unusual activities. Enhanced transparency discourages malicious practices that could lead to unnecessary volatility.
Standardized clearing and settlement systems further support transparency by ensuring efficient and timely post-trade processing. Clear procedures decrease counterparty risks and promote a stable environment, contributing to more consistent market liquidity.
Efforts to improve market transparency are complemented by measures like increased surveillance technology and stricter enforcement actions. These initiatives collectively aim to reduce market volatility and enhance investor confidence within futures exchanges.

Analysis of Liquidity Patterns During Periods of Market Stress
During periods of market stress, liquidity patterns in futures trading often exhibit notable shifts. Typically, trading volumes decline as uncertainty increases, resulting in wider bid-ask spreads and reduced market depth. This reduction hampers the ability of market participants to execute large orders without significant price impact.
Reduced liquidity can lead to increased volatility, as fewer buy and sell orders are available to absorb large swings in prices. In such times, futures exchanges may experience heightened bid-ask spreads, reflecting a deterioration in market efficiency. These patterns are often temporary but can intensify during major economic shocks or geopolitical events.
Understanding liquidity behavior during market stress is vital for traders and regulators. It informs risk management strategies and helps design safeguards to maintain market stability. Despite some resilience in futures markets, prolonged stress can challenge overall market liquidity, emphasizing the importance of monitoring these patterns closely during turbulent periods.
